How to Use PSD Mockup

To use a PSD Mockup, follow these steps:

  1. Choose a PSD Mockup: There are various websites and marketplaces where you can find free or paid PSD Mockup files. Look for a mockup that suits your needs and download the PSD file to your computer.
  2. Extract the ZIP File: If the downloaded mockup is in a ZIP file, extract its contents to a folder on your computer.
  3. Install Adobe Photoshop: PSD files are designed to be opened and edited in Adobe Photoshop. If you don’t have Photoshop installed on your computer, you’ll need to download and install it.
  4. Open the PSD File: Launch Adobe Photoshop and open the PSD file by going to “File” > “Open” and selecting the mockup PSD file from the folder where you saved it.
  5. Save Your Work: Once you’re satisfied with the customization, save your work as a PSD file or export it in a suitable format for your purpose (e.g., JPEG, PNG). Go to “File” > “Save As” or “Export” and choose the desired file format and location.

That’s it! You have successfully used a PSD Mockup to present your design or artwork. Remember to follow any specific instructions provided with the mockup file and experiment with different customization options to achieve the desired result.
